Answer:

\sqrt{74}

Step-by-step explanation:

<u>Distance between two points</u>

d=\sqrt{(x_2-x_1)^2+(y_2-y_1)^2}

\textsf{let}\:(x_1,y_1)=(2,-6)

\textsf{let}\:(x_2,y_2)=(7,1)

d=\textsf{length of segment AB}

Substituting points into the distance formula and solving for d:

\implies d=\sqrt{(7-2)^2+(1-(-6))^2}

\implies d=\sqrt{5^2+7^2}

\implies d=\sqrt{25+49}

\implies d=\sqrt{74}
